This is an automated email from the ASF dual-hosted git repository.

yashmayya p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/pinot.git


    from 8af86e0783 Fix MIN_MAX_RANGE aggregation function behavior when all 
input values are null (#15525)
     add ecc367c797 Add null handling support for MV aggregation functions - 
COUNT, MIN, MAX, SUM, AVG, MINMAXRANGE (#15524)

No new revisions were added by this update.

Summary of changes:
 .../function/AggregationFunctionFactory.java       |  12 +-
 .../function/AvgMVAggregationFunction.java         |  59 ++++---
 .../function/CountMVAggregationFunction.java       |  50 +++---
 .../function/MaxAggregationFunction.java           |   4 +-
 .../function/MaxMVAggregationFunction.java         |  99 ++++++++----
 .../function/MinAggregationFunction.java           |   4 +-
 .../function/MinMVAggregationFunction.java         |  99 ++++++++----
 .../function/MinMaxRangeMVAggregationFunction.java |  60 ++++---
 .../function/SumAggregationFunction.java           |   4 +-
 .../function/SumMVAggregationFunction.java         |  95 ++++++++---
 .../function/AvgMVAggregationFunctionTest.java     | 176 ++++++++++++++++++++
 .../function/CountMVAggregationFunctionTest.java   | 117 ++++++++++++++
 .../function/MaxMVAggregationFunctionTest.java     | 166 +++++++++++++++++++
 .../function/MinMVAggregationFunctionTest.java     | 173 ++++++++++++++++++++
 .../MinMaxRangeMVAggregationFunctionTest.java      | 170 ++++++++++++++++++++
 .../function/SumMVAggregationFunctionTest.java     | 177 +++++++++++++++++++++
 .../org/apache/pinot/queries/FluentQueryTest.java  |   3 +-
 .../pinot/segment/local/customobject/AvgPair.java  |   5 +
 18 files changed, 1316 insertions(+), 157 deletions(-)
 create mode 100644 
pinot-core/src/test/java/org/apache/pinot/core/query/aggregation/function/AvgMVAggregationFunctionTest.java
 create mode 100644 
pinot-core/src/test/java/org/apache/pinot/core/query/aggregation/function/CountMVAggregationFunctionTest.java
 create mode 100644 
pinot-core/src/test/java/org/apache/pinot/core/query/aggregation/function/MaxMVAggregationFunctionTest.java
 create mode 100644 
pinot-core/src/test/java/org/apache/pinot/core/query/aggregation/function/MinMVAggregationFunctionTest.java
 create mode 100644 
pinot-core/src/test/java/org/apache/pinot/core/query/aggregation/function/MinMaxRangeMVAggregationFunctionTest.java
 create mode 100644 
pinot-core/src/test/java/org/apache/pinot/core/query/aggregation/function/SumMVAggregationFunctionTest.java


---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scr...@pinot.apache.org
For additional commands, e-mail: commits-h...@pinot.apache.org

Reply via email to